Description
The Data Clerk will be based within a hospital setting and will support the Maternal and Neonatal Health Program by ensuring accurate, timely, and complete collection, entry, and reporting of data generated from routine clinical care and approved research activities. The role involves working closely with healthcare providers and research teams to support hospital record systems and maintain high-quality data essential for clinical audits, program monitoring, evaluation, and research reporting. Responsibilities include but are not limited to the following Data Entry of MNH data into program databases and electronic registers in a timely manner Checks M&E tools, and ensures adequate supplies for data capture. Participating in data collection and entry for program research projects and helps organize electronic and paper files at the facility. Assisting in the preparation and collection of Monthly MNH and MOH reports and participates in monthly meetings as directed. Notifying program management of data collection or integrity issues early and assists with data cleaning and validation to maintain high data quality. Aiding in securing data through daily backups of the electronic database Participating in quarterly and biannual supervisions and data quality assurance exercises, along with providing mentorship in data practices. Maintaining operations in line with policies and procedures and reports necessary changes. Verifying entered data by reviewing, correcting, deleting, or reentering data; combining data from multiple sources if it is incomplete; purging files to eliminate duplication of data. Ensuring strict confidentiality of all records and information handled. Adhere to organizational policies on data protection and privacy. Filing patient records in accordance with hospital and Ministry of Health record-keeping standards Retrieving patient case files from the records office as required Ensuring safe keeping, proper filing, and tracking of hospital records Tracing and availing patient files for clinicians during re-admissions, follow-up visits, or clinical reviews Collecting patient outcome and follow-up data through phone calls or site visits to referral facilities, as directed by the supervisor and in line with program protocol Any other duties as may be assigned from time to time. Certificate in computer studies Basic computer skills and demonstration of experience in data entry Malawi School Certificate of Education Ability to report matters/problems in a timely and professional manner Excellent attention to details and high level of integrity.
